Job Description






Purpose



SAII/Chemonics seeks a Procurement Officer to assist with all activities related to program procurement for LUWASH in Nigeria. 



Reporting



This position reports to the LUWASH Procurement Specialist



Job Summary



Under supervision of the Procurement Specialist, the Procurement Officer shall procure project materials, equipment and services in compliance with USAID and SAII/Chemonics rules and regulations to meet the objectives of the project. S/he will assist in the organization of procurement files and preparation of payment requests for procurements and subcontracts.



Specific Responsibilities 




  • Assist in procuring project materials, equipment, and services in compliance with USAID and SAII/Chemonics rules and regulations to meet project objectives.

  • Work with local, regional, and international vendors to obtain quotations and initiate procurements as requested by the Procurement Specialist.

  • Organize procurement files and ensure all required documentation is complete and properly filed, both electronically (and in hard copy when needed).

  • Prepare and process payment requests for procurements and subcontracts, ensuring accuracy and compliance with established procedures.

  • Assist in developing requests for proposals (RFPs) and requests for quotations (RFQs) and help collect and respond to questions from offerors.

  • Support the drafting of evaluation summaries and memoranda of negotiation.

  • Assist in maintaining the accuracy and completeness of the project’s procurement and subcontracts tracking system.

  • Assists in tracking progress and performance under BPAs and contracts.

  • Assist in preparing procurement-related approval documentation for submission to USAID/Nigeria.

  • Support in caring out hotel assessments across the states the project visits for the establishment of  blanket purchase agreements (BPAs).

  • Provide procurement status updates to project staff.

  • Assist in providing training to project staff on procurement policies and procedures.

  • Ensure all procurement activities comply with Chemonics corporate policies, contractual requirements, U.S. Federal Acquisition Regulations (FAR), and Agency for International Development Acquisition Regulations (AIDAR).

  • Perform any other duties as assigned by the Procurement Specialist.



Qualifications




  • A minimum of a bachelor’s degree in a relevant field.

  • At least 4 years of experience working in the operations/procurement unit of donor-funded projects in Nigeria required.

  • Experience working on USAID or other donor funded projects preferred.

  • Demonstrable knowledge of USAID rules and regulations surrounding procurements. 

  • Excellent interpersonal, organizational, and prioritization skills. 

  • Ability to work both independently on a team, under tight deadlines, and with versatility and integrity. 

  • Fluency in English. 

  • Good analytical ability and writing skills, with excellent working knowledge of MS Office Suite.



Duration



This is a long-term assignment. The expected duration is at least one year. This position will be based in Lagos. No relocation provision is provided.
